I ended up cheating and pulling the .inf, .sys, and .pnf files off of a
working 2008 non-R2 x64 install and loading the driver onto the R2 x64
install. Despite a warning about an unsigned driver, the driver loaded and
it seems to be working fine.
Note that the card wasn't even listed (that I can find) on that
WindowsServerCatalog site as compatible with 2K8, though Microsoft included
the driver with the non-R2 OS.
